# Context: this env file dates from the Holloway FD-leak hunt.
# Barnacle workers were exhausting descriptors under load; tracing
# required the profiler sidecar, which stays enabled here. Do not
# remove the sidecar flags until the leak fix ships in 3.9.
# The sidecar needs an auth credential to push traces upstream,
# so the next line must remain directly below this comment.

secret setting of hawep-yahig: LEDGER_TOKEN29=41b5d6315371c92885eaeb077fb63

## Releases

Hey support folks — quick notes on ProfileMesh shard releases. Each release re-balances user-profile shards gradually, so don't panic if a lookup lands on a stale shard for a few minutes post-deploy; it self-heals. Release bundles are published twice a month and are always signed. If a customer asks you to verify a bundle they downloaded, walk them through the checksum step using the public signing key below.

deploy key for kawif-bageg: bky19_YQNdHDgpaLxUNwPoHm9

Subject: DR drill results — autocomplete index

Team,

Thursday's drill exposed the slow autocomplete index on Fernbrook search. Rebuild took 40 minutes; target is 10. We'll shard it before the next drill. Restoring the index service requires the recovery passphrase at the failover console. For the sync, it's noted below.

unlock words, bagag-kajef: zormir-jorath-tammir-oliius-briix-norys

For the heads of department: the proposed franchise agreement with Marrowgate Hospitality covers twelve Westlan-region locations over five years. Terms include a 6% royalty, shared fit-out costs, and exclusive territory rights. Legal has cleared the draft subject to minor indemnity revisions; operations confirms training capacity for a phased rollout. Outstanding items are brand-standard audits and the termination schedule. Leadership should weigh these against our capital priorities, which are summarized in the confidential note below.

board note of kageg-bahof: The renewal with Holwynax Holdings closes at $2 million a year, 5 percent below the last contract. Project Ulaath slips by two quarters because of the supplier delay.